About the Role
The Design Director will lead all design and development processes across the home division. This is a remarkable opportunity to define the look and feel of the WS Home brand and drive innovation in WSH approach to product development. The Design Director will also manage product design for all categories. Reporting into the Vice President, this role oversees a team of designers to produce new products that reflect brand strategy, market trends, and meet customer needs.
Responsibilities
Articulate a clear and passionate point of view regarding print, pattern and color for WSH
Create quarterly seasonal concepts
Oversee creation of original artwork and manipulation of purchased print work to fit seasonal direction.
Maintain an understanding of the print/vintage studios available and books appropriate studios based on business needs.
Regularly shop competitors to keep abreast of trends. Travel Europe/Asia to identify emerging themes and new inspirations
Oversee design and development of assigned categories from concept to completion. • Ensure that design team successfully translates seasonal direction into viable product.
Present and sell seasonal design direction to merchandising team and executives, identify key business driving ideas and items.
Identify big business ideas to be developed and ensure Designers have clear understanding of the product line.
Ensure that all final design details and pre-production samples are approved by Designers (with Product Development). Resolve escalated issues.
Drive innovation in these categories with regards to color, pattern, and construction.
Achieve operational excellence in product development:
Partner with merchants to ensure needs/briefs are clear, meaningful, and support seasonal big ideas.
Manage product development to the brand calendar and achieve key milestone dates.
Utilize multiple internal and external data sources to inform the early stages of our design brief and product development process.
Criteria
Proven track record of a strong ability to conceptualize design across multiple product categories
Minimum 7-10 years product design experience.
Minimum 4-year college degree or equivalent experience.
5 years of management experience
Must have ability to provide feedback, participate in the annual and ongoing performance management process, etc.
Strong Aesthetic Vision, People Development & Management skills, Presentation Skills, and Business Acumen in the Home Industry
